Frequently Asked Questions about Pima County

How much are Studio apartments in Pima County?

There are currently 311 Studio Apartments in Pima County with rent ranges from $600 to $2,300 with an average price of $1,107.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Pima County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Pima County ranges from $560 to $4,516 with an average monthly rent of $1,246.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Pima County c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Pima County range from $440 to $4,909.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,583.

How expensive are Pima County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 384 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Pima County on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$599 to $5,443 - averaging $1,877 for the location.
